Men's Cross Country Gears Up For NCAA Championship
Nov. 19, 2009
AUBURN, Ala.- The 2009 Auburn men's cross country squad continue its 2009 campaign by heading to the NCAA Championship. Indiana State University will host the Championships, Nov. 23, at the LaVern Gibson Championship Course located at the Wabash Valley Family Sports Center in Terre Haute, Ind. The men's race will begin at approximately 11:08 a.m. Central time, followed by the women'srace at approximately 11:58 a.m. Both championship races will be broadcast live on Versus Network and streamed online via NCAA.com. The men's team got some good news on Nov. 15 as the team learned it will return to the NCAA Championships for the second time in as many years, the USTFCCCA announced. In order to be eligible to participate in the championships, teams and individuals qualified in their respective NCAA regions on Nov. 13. Thirty-one teams were selected to participate in each championship. The top two teams automatically qualified from each of the nine regions, for a total of 18 teams. Thirteen additional teams were selected at-large, a category that the Tigers fit into after finishing third as a team at the recent NCAA South Regional meet. The Tigers are one of three SEC teams that qualified for the race, along with South Region Champion Alabama and South Central Region Champion Arkansas. Last season, the Tigers finished fifth as a team, a mark that the Tigers will look to eclipse this year. Three runners, Felix Kiboiywo, Scott Novack and Jean-Pierre Weerts all ran at last season's race and will bring valuable experience to the fold.
